Collaboration Strategies That Strengthen Storytelling Impact
Effective brand storytelling with creators requires more than product placement. It begins with selecting creators whose values, audience, and communication style align naturally with the brand. Once a partnership is established, brands benefit from giving creators creative freedom to interpret stories through their own voice. This freedom preserves authenticity and ensures the content feels consistent with the creator’s existing relationship with their audience. Long term partnerships further enhance storytelling because they allow themes to develop gradually, building familiarity and trust over time. When creator collaboration is approached as a shared narrative rather than a transactional exchange, the resulting stories feel richer and more meaningful.
